Los de la GS are a popular corridos tumbados group making waves in the Mexican music scene. Known for their raw lyrics and hard-hitting beats, they've quickly gained a dedicated following. Tracks like "El Machete," "La Ratoniza," and "Tambien Me Llamo Ismael" showcase their signature style, blending traditional corridos elements with a modern trap influence. They've also released several live recordings, like "Compa Turi (En Vivo)," capturing the energy of their performances.
While details about the group's formation and individual members remain relatively scarce, their music speaks volumes. Their recent releases, including "¿Y Que Paso?" and "Ya Te Perdí La Fe," continue to explore themes of street life, loyalty, and personal struggles, resonating with a growing audience.
